Iconic Burracoppin Landmark - History, Space & Lifestyle
Perfectly positioned on the Great Eastern Highway midway between Perth and Kalgoorlie, the Old Burracoppin Hotel is a hard-to-miss Wheatbelt icon offering a truly unique lifestyle opportunity.
Once the beating heart of a thriving farming community, this grand full-brick landmark has been thoughtfully transformed into an expansive private residence while proudly retaining its historic charm. High ceilings, polished original jarrah floorboards, a massive dining room and six generous bedrooms upstairs create a sense of space and character rarely found. Three of the bedrooms feature French door access to the wide veranda, adding to the building's timeless appeal.
Comfort has not been overlooked, with solar panels helping to reduce running costs, along with air-conditioning throughout to ensure year-round comfort.
A true standout is the original, fully functional public bar - now repurposed as the ultimate entertainer's space or "husband's retreat"- complete with an undercover beer garden that perfectly suits relaxed country living and memorable gatherings.
Adding even more character, the property is filled with historic antiques, all of which are included in the sale, allowing the next owner to step straight into the rich story and atmosphere of this remarkable building.
Set on the corner of five quarter-acre blocks totalling over 5,000sqm, the property offers exceptional scope for future expansion or additional accommodation (STCA). The current owners have already invested significant time and money into the property; however, a change in circumstances now presents a rare opportunity for a new custodian to take the reins and continue its legacy.
